Lets compare vitamin content per 14 ounces of Tomato Juice with Salt vs Lotus Root:
- 14 ounces of Tomato Juice with Salt have more Vitamin A, 1.7 times more Vitamin B3, 1.5 times more Vitamin B9 and 1.6 times more Vitamin C than Lotus Root.
- While 14 oz of Raw Lotus Root contain 1.6 times more Vitamin B1, 2.8 times more Vitamin B2 and 3.7 times more Vitamin B6 than Canned Tomato Juice with Salt.
- 14 ounces of Lotus Root have insufficient amounts of Vitamin A
- Both Canned Tomato Juice with Salt as well as Raw Lotus Root have insufficient amounts of Vitamin B12 and Vitamin D in 14 ounces.
Comparing minerals per 14 ounces for Tomato Juice with Salt vs Lotus Root:
- 14 ounces of Tomato Juice with Salt have 6.3 times more Sodium than Lotus Root.
- While 14 oz of Raw Lotus Root contain 4.5 times more Calcium, 6.1 times more Copper, 3 times more Iron, 2.1 times more Magnesium, 3.8 times more Manganese, 5.3 times more Phosphorus, 2.6 times more Potassium and 3.5 times more Zinc than Canned Tomato Juice with Salt.
- Both Tomato Juice with Salt and Lotus Root contain similar levels of Water per 14 ounces.
- 14 ounces of Tomato Juice with Salt lack sufficient amounts of Calcium and Zinc
- Both Canned Tomato Juice with Salt as well as Raw Lotus Root lack sufficient amounts of Selenium in 14 ounces.
Comparison of macro-nutrients per 14 ounces:
- 14 oz of Raw Lotus Root contain 4.4 times more Energy, 4.9 times more Carbohydrate, 12.3 times more Fiber and 3.1 times more Protein than Canned Tomato Juice with Salt.
- 14 ounces of Tomato Juice with Salt provide inadequate amounts of Energy, Fiber and Protein
- Both Canned Tomato Juice with Salt as well as Raw Lotus Root provide inadequate amounts of Omega 3 and Omega 6 in 14 ounces.
